In Japan, it has long been a tradition for women to give chocolates to men on Valentine's Day. And not just for romantic reasons: women are often expected to give giri choco — or "obligatory chocolates" — to show appreciation to their male coworkers and bosses as well.

However, in a new survey from Nippon Life Insurance Co., 71% of women and 74% of men said they thought giving giri choco was unnecessary. In the online survey of over 11,000 men and women, just 35% said they would give someone a present on Valentine's Day this year. Of these, 64% said they would give something to a spouse or partner, while just 13% said they would give something to a coworker.

also another interesting thing is in May japan has a day called white day where the guys have to give back their giri choco to the ladies.

🎂 Introducing Birthday Bot! 🥳

Hey everyone! I just built a Telegram bot that automatically wishes members of a group a heartfelt Happy Birthday on their special day! 🎈🎊

💡 Features:
Sends randomized heartfelt messages from a collection of 100+ unique wishes.
Works automatically—no need to set reminders!
Helps foster a positive community by celebrating every member’s birthday.

🛠 Commands & How to Use
📌 /start – Activates the bot and provides basic info.
📌 /addbirthday [username] [DD-MM] – Registers your birthday in the system.
Example: /addbirthday @brooksolo 17-01
📌 /deletebirthday [username]– Removes your stored birthday from the system in that group chat.
Example: /deletebirthday @brooksolo
📌 /upcomingbirthdays [days] – Lists upcoming birthdays within the given time range.
Example: /upcomingbirthdays 1m shows birthdays in the next one month.
📌 /listbirthdays – Displays all registered birthdays in the group or private message.

This month's challenge is "Feb-Africa."

How It Works

The challenge is simple: immerse yourself in African cinema throughout February. The goal is to watch at least 7 films from anywhere in Africa. We encourage you to explore different genres, time periods, and regions, but most importantly, have fun discovering new cinematic voices!

How to Participate

There isn't a strict list of films – this is about exploring and discovering! Feel free to dive into any African films that pique your interest.

if you have highlights and book anotations you want to export and your pdf reader does not support that then don't worry because pdfannots exists. its simple as
pdfannots yourfile.pdf > output.md it can output txt and json too for more help check the man page and don't forget to star them on github

https://github.com/0xabu/pdfannots
